Because supply chain attacks compromise a higher number of victims with less effort, cybercriminals are unlikely to forgo this efficient attack method without a fight.
So the chances of suffering a supply chain attack are higher and the repercussions are more costly than ever before.
A vendor risk assessment is a process of evaluating the potential security risks associated with a vendor's operations and products.
The purpose of vendor risk assessments is to help organizations understand the security risks associated with each vendor.
The purpose of a vendor risk management policy is to keep all stakeholders informed of the details of a vendor risk management program.
